Intrusion In and out my climbing roses A mother robin flew And from my window I could spot A little beak or two Curious now to know the count I opened up the door The mother flew with rumpled speed She’d never flown before I kept my distance from the nest And stretched to take a peek But mother robin then unleashed A reprimanding screech I backed away and went inside To view the nest once more And back she came with food in mouth Continuing her chore So rude was I to thus intrude Into a bird’s domain Interrupting mother’s feeding As she announced my shame My rose arbor is not my own My sense is finely tuned That I must wait some time before My roses can be pruned Elizabeth Santos |
